What are the responsibilities and job description for the Open Education Librarian position at Western Oregon University?
Western Oregon University is seeking a passionate and innovative Open Education Librarian to lead the charge in making learning more accessible and affordable for students. In this pivotal role, you’ll champion open educational resources (OER), promote affordable course materials, and collaborate with campus partners to develop strategies that ease the financial burden of textbooks. You’ll work closely with faculty to identify, create, and adopt OER materials and explore alternative textbook models, empowering students to succeed.

Qualifications
- Master’s degree from an American Library Association (ALA) accredited school
- 1 or more years of experience supporting the adoption, adaptation, and/or creation of open educational resources
- 1 or more years of demonstrated experience coordinating projects and working collaboratively with diverse stakeholders, such as faculty, staff, and external individuals and organizations
- 3 or more years of experience using common productivity tools (Google suite, Zoom, MS Office, etc)
- 1 or more years of experience using basic accessibility checkers
